| Title: | RETENTION PONDS REDUCE FLOOD DISCHARGE |
| Caption: | (a) Comparison of runoff from a paved area, which goes directly through a storm drain to a stream with runoff that is stored temporarily in a retention pond before draining to a stream. The graph shows that the use of a retention pond reduces peak discharge and the likelihood that the runoff will contribute to flooding of the stream.
